The Diagnosis: Why Modern Small Spaces Suffer Most

Our apartments, dorm rooms, and RVs are engineered to be more energy-efficient than ever, with tight seals to keep the elements out and the conditioned air in. But this laudable efficiency comes with an unintended trade-off: they also become perfect traps for moisture. Every shower, every pot of pasta boiled on the stove, every load of laundry, and even every breath you take releases water vapor into the air with nowhere to go. This inevitably leads to a classic physics problem that becomes most apparent in winter: condensation. When your warm, moisture-laden indoor air makes contact with a cold surface like a windowpane, its temperature plummets. It instantly hits the “dew point,” the temperature at which the invisible vapor can no longer stay in its gaseous form and transforms into visible liquid water. Those weeping windows aren’t just an aesthetic issue; they are a clear symptom of a room’s high relative humidity, a blinking red light indicating that your personal microclimate is out of balance. This persistently trapped moisture is the ideal breeding ground for allergens, silently turning your cozy sanctuary into a potential source of respiratory irritation and discomfort.

A Different Kind of Cure: Understanding Peltier Technology

To effectively combat this localized, persistent humidity, you don’t need the roaring, energy-hungry compressor of a traditional basement dehumidifier. That would be like using a fire hose to water a delicate houseplant—overkill, and wildly inefficient for the task. What you need is a different kind of cure, one built on the principles of quiet precision and efficiency: the Peltier effect.

At the heart of a new generation of compact dehumidifiers, including the well-regarded TABYIK DH-CS01, is a thermoelectric cooler—a small, solid-state device with no moving parts save for a small fan. The simplest way to think of it is as a tiny, silent, solid-state heat pump. When a direct current of electricity passes through it, a fascinating phenomenon occurs: one side gets cold while the other side gets warm. A small, nearly silent fan draws your room’s humid air across the device’s cold side. As the air passes over this chilled surface, the moisture within it rapidly cools, condenses into water droplets (replicating the dew point effect in a controlled way), and drips neatly into a collection tank. The now-drier, crisper air is then guided over the warm side before being circulated back into the room. The Right Tool for the Right Job: Is This “Surgical Scalpel” for You?

The most critical element in solving any problem effectively is choosing the right tool. A powerful compressor-based dehumidifier is a broadsword—it’s heavy, loud, and designed to hack away at major humidity problems in a large, wet basement. A Peltier dehumidifier, in stark contrast, is a surgical scalpel. Its value is not in raw power, but in its precision, finesse, and suitability for targeted, sensitive applications.

To determine if this specialized tool is the right prescription for your humidity symptoms, consider the following checklist:

This Dehumidifier is Likely Your Ideal Solution If…

  • You are tackling a specific, localized humidity problem within a small, relatively enclosed space (ideally under 280 sq. ft.).
  • Your primary frustration is visible condensation on windows, mirrors, or toilet tanks.
  • You need to proactively control dampness in a walk-in closet, a small bathroom, a laundry room, or a home office.
  • You live in an RV, boat, or dorm room where physical space and energy consumption are critical constraints.
  • Noise is your primary enemy, and you require a solution that can run continuously in your bedroom or workspace without creating any distraction.

You Should Look for a “Broadsword” (Compressor Model) If…

  • You need to dehumidify a large room, an open-concept living area, or an entire apartment.
  • You are dealing with a significant water intrusion event, such as a leaking basement, a burst pipe, or post-flood cleanup.
  • The room you want to treat is consistently cold (below 59°F or 15°C). The efficiency of Peltier technology drops significantly at lower ambient temperatures.
  • Your goal is to rapidly decrease the overall humidity of a large, very damp area by a significant margin.
